Temperature level Considerations



When it pertains to commercial outside painting, temperature plays a critical function in the outcome of your project. If you're painting in extreme warm, the paint can dry also swiftly, bring about concerns like inadequate attachment and unequal coatings. You intend to go for tem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best outcomes. Below 50 ° F, paint may not treat effectively, while over 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and splitting.

Timing your job with the right temperature levels is necessary. Beginning your work early in the morning or later on in the mid-day when it's cooler, specifically throughout warm months.

Additionally, take into consideration the surface temperature level; it can be significantly more than the air temperature level, especially on warm days. Make use of a surface thermometer to examine this before you start.

If temperatures are uncertain, watch on the weather report. Sudden temperature level drops or heat waves can hinder your strategies. You don't wish to begin repainting just to have the problems alter mid-project.

Humidity Levels



Humidity levels significantly influence the success of your industrial external painting project. When the humidity is expensive, it can impede paint drying and healing, bring about a range of issues like poor adhesion and finish top quality.

If you're preparing a work throughout moist conditions, you could locate that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can prolong your project timeline and rise costs.

Alternatively, reduced humidity can additionally position challenges. Paint may dry also quickly, protecting against proper application and leading to an irregular finish.

You'll wish to monitor the humidity levels very closely to ensure you're working within the ideal variety, commonly in between 40% and 70%.

To obtain the most effective outcomes, consider using a hygrometer to determine humidity before beginning your job.

If you find the levels are outside the optimal array, you might require to change your routine or choose paints created for variable problems.

Always seek advice from the producer's guidelines for certain recommendations on moisture resistance.

Rainfall Impact



Rain or snow can substantially disrupt your commercial outside paint strategies. When precipitation occurs, it can remove fresh used paint or create an uneven coating. Preferably, you want to select days with completely dry climate to make certain the paint sticks properly and remedies successfully. If you're captured in a rain shower, it's ideal to halt the job and await problems to improve.
